Location and Accessibility

Arrowhead State Park Campground is located in Johnston County, Oklahoma, with the provided address being Oklahoma 73460, USA. More specifically, it is situated on a peninsula of Lake Eufaula, Oklahoma's largest lake, offering excellent access to water-based activities and scenic views. For precise navigation, the park's main address is often listed as 3995 Main Park Rd, Canadian, OK 74425.

Accessibility to Arrowhead State Park is quite convenient for Oklahomans. It is located approximately 18 miles north of McAlester on Highway 69, and about 4 miles east of Canadian, also off Highway 69. Highway 69 is a major north-south artery in eastern Oklahoma, making the park easily reachable from various parts of the state. The roads leading into the park are generally well-maintained, accommodating RVs and trailers of all sizes. The park's position on Lake Eufaula means that once you arrive, you are immediately surrounded by the beauty of the lake and its expansive shoreline, offering a true escape into nature without being overly remote. Features / Highlights

Arrowhead State Park Campground is rich with features and highlights that make it a compelling destination for a diverse range of outdoor enthusiasts in Oklahoma.

  • Lake Eufaula Access: As one of Oklahoma's largest man-made lakes, Lake Eufaula offers extensive opportunities for fishing (known for largemouth bass, crappie, catfish, and sand bass), boating, waterskiing, wakeboarding, canoeing, and kayaking. The on-site marina provides easy water access and services.
  • Diverse Camping Options: With 91 RV and tent sites, including 20 full hookup RV sites and a separate equestrian campground, the park caters to various camping styles, from modern RVs to primitive tent setups and horse-friendly camping.
  • Extensive Trail System: The park boasts 25 miles of equestrian trails and several hiking trails. The Outlaw Nature Trail is a popular, relatively easy 0.75-mile trail through hilly terrain, while the 3-mile Arrowhead Hiking Trail is more challenging and recommended for advanced hikers, linking campgrounds.
  • Arrowhead Golf Course: A significant highlight is the full-service, par-72 Arrowhead Golf Course. It features hybrid Bermuda greens, Bermuda grass tees and fairways, minimal water hazards, and offers spectacular lake views from several holes, appealing to golf enthusiasts.
  • Wildlife Viewing: The park is home to a variety of wildlife, including deer, wild turkeys, and rabbits, offering opportunities for bird watching and nature photography.
